33. Deputy Claire Kerrane asked the Minister for Transport if the NDLS will be allowing for the extension of driver licences given the latest level 5 Covid restrictions; if his attention has been drawn to the difficulties persons are having with only being able to renew their driver licences online at this time and that those without access to a computer cannot seek assistance at their local library or any of the other usual places they would seek help; if he will engage with the NDLS to allow for an extension to driver licences;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[4841/21]
